THE NAVAL DANCE.

This, year as last, the Thames JNaval Brigade hold an eren'ng prriy in connee-

tion with the "JBrigado Drill Assembly, ■and. as the day lias bncn so wet as to preclude the possibility of cut-door sports, wo have no doubt thrt the dance, or parly, will bo well attended and we!], enjoyed. Tho Hall has bean carefully prepared aud hung with, flags, and a merry night may bo expected for those who wi'l attend this evening.
